Sec. 370.161. TRANSPORTATION PROJECTS EXTENDING INTO OTHER COUNTIES. An authority may study, evaluate, design, finance, acquire, construct, operate, maintain, repair, expand, or extend a transportation project in:

(1)a county that is a part of the authority;
(2)a county in this state that is not a part of the authority if the county and authority enter into an agreement under Section 370.033 (f); or
(3)a county in another state or the United Mexican States if:
(A)each governing body of a political subdivision in which the project will be located agrees to the proposed study, evaluation, design, financing, acquisition, construction, operation, maintenance, repair, expansion, or extension;

Legislative History

Added by Acts 2003, 78th Leg., ch. 1325, Sec. 2.01, eff. June 21, 2003. Amended by: Acts 2005, 79th Leg., Ch. 281 (H.B. 2702 ), Sec. 2.102, eff. June 14, 2005. Acts 2013, 83rd Leg., R.S., Ch. 118 (S.B. 1489 ), Sec. 3, eff. May 18, 2013.
